Here is a bowl of many good things put together. The spices work well together and this dish works well for a family meal (servings 4 – 8) or you can make this dish a side if you would like to add meat.
Ingredients
- 1⁄2teaspoon vegetable oil
- 2green onions, chopped
- 1sweet red pepper
- 1garlic clove, minced
- 2tomatoes, chopped
- 1zucchini, diced
- 1cup chickpeas, cooked
- 1cup boiling water
- 1⁄4teaspoon salt
- 1⁄2teaspoon curry powder
- 1teaspoon ground cumin
- 2tablespoons fresh parsley
- 1⁄8te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 1⁄2teaspoon ginger
- 1⁄4teaspoon cayenne
- 1cup couscous
Directions
- In a medium-size skillet heat the oil.
- Add green onions, sweet pepper, garlic, tomatoes and zucchini; saute 5 min, stirring.
- Remove from heat and keep warm.
- In a medium-size saucepan, combine the remaining ingredients, mix, cover and let stand 5 minutes, until liquid is absorbed. Add the first mixture and fluff with a fork.
